Paris Trade Seminar - Apr 11th

Angelos Theodorakpoulos

Angelos THEODORAKPOULOS is Assistant Professor of Economics at the Department of Economics, Finance and Entrepreneurship of Aston Business School. Before joining Aston, he held research posts at the University of Oxford and KU Leuven, where he was involved in various externally funded research projects, and served as consultant at the World Bank. He is also an Academic Visitor at the Bank of England and has ongoing projects at the National Bank of Belgium.

His research interests span international trade, empirical industrial organisation, productivity, technological change, intangibles, applied microeconomics & econometrics.

Angelos THEODORAKPOULOS will present a paper, joint with Bruno Merlevede, at the next Paris Trade Seminar on the theme:

Intangibles within Firm Boundaries (read paper)

More about Angelos THEODORAKPOULOS and his research

Date: TUESDAY, April 11th - 2:30 PM
Location: PSE - Jourdan Campus - Room R2-01
